9 Most Instagrammable Spots in West Hollywood

Perfect your selfie at these picture-perfect locations.


West Hollywood is arguably one of the most Instagrammable cities in the world. Just head to the infamous Paul Smith pink wall, and you will see influencers, TikTok creators and tourists vying for valuable wall real estate.

This is a great backdrop, but West Hollywood has so much more to offer your social media feed. Here are some of our current faves in and around WeHo.

Local tip: the landscape changes constantly, so check our Instagram to keep up with the latest.

1. Paul Smith Pink Wall

You may as well start here because, as we mentioned, it gets pretty hectic. We suggest an early start to avoid any unwanted photobombing. Bonus: Carrera Café across the street often features a great wall too.

Where to Find It:  8221 Melrose Avenue, Los Angeles, CA 90046

2. Carrera Café

Just steps away from the pink wall is Carrera Café, where you can take photos and fuel up for the rest of your tour. This sunny, black-and-white tiled shop sells sandwiches, salads, adorable pastries, and other breakfast and lunch fare. They embrace their enviable location with a mural wall program and encourage you to tag them for a chance to be featured.

Where to Find It: 8251 Melrose Avenue, Los Angeles, CA 90046

3. The Walkway at 1 Hotel

Catch an Uber or hike up to the 1 Hotel. They have a lovely walkway with water feature, Dream Catcher by Janet Echelman, and breathtaking views of the city. It’s a great spot to get that “casually walking” shot.

Where To Find It:  8490 Sunset Blvd, West Hollywood, CA 90069

4. Alfred at Glossier Alley

The whole Alfred family is photogenic, but there is something so charming about this little spot in the alley. Blink, and you just may miss it. Fountains and outdoor seating make it a perfect place to take a break and a pic. Local tip: Hop next door to Glossier or get a portrait shot on the dramatic wall. They don’t even seem to mind if you take pics inside, but as always, be conscious of their guests. Only some people want to be on your feed.

Where to Find It:  8509 Melrose Avenue, West Hollywood, CA 90069

5. Great White

Keep heading West and check out European-inspired aesthetic with plastered walls, soft woods, clay wall lights, and zellige tiles of Great White. Grab a bite to eat and have someone shoot your effortless catwalk exiting the chic restaurant.

Where to Find It:  8917 Melrose Ave, West Hollywood, CA 90069

SUR in West Hollywood

6. The Vanderpump Empire

Head north on Robertson for Lisa Vanderpump’s two West Hollywood restaurants: SUR and TomTom. They’re both camera-ready in their own ways and located steps from each other. Check their hours because you may just spot a reality TV cast member while you grab something to eat, especially on weekends.

Where To Find It:  Start at 606 North Robertson, West Hollywood, CA 90069

7. James Peter Henry at La Peer 

While in the Design District, pop over to Kimpton La Peer Hotel and check out James Peter Henry’s studio. His working studio anchors the boutique hotel’s patio, adding to the creative vibe. Local tip: His murals can be seen at other spots in the city – visit his Instagram to keep up with his latest.

Where to Find It:  8917 Melrose Ave, West Hollywood, CA 90069

Andaz Hotel West Hollywood - Photo 5

8. Music Murals at Andaz West Hollywood

Leave it to this iconic Sunset Strip hotel, once known as the Riot House, to reimagine its parking lot as a living art exhibition. Muralists have been invited to showcase their best music legend-inspired work.

Where To Find It: 8401 Sunset Boulevard, West Hollywood, CA 90069

9. WeHo Pickup

Feeling like a night shoot? Take the free WeHo PickUp for your hop-on-hop-off-grab-a-shot-take-a-shot photo excursion. Check out this route – it basically takes you through the whole city and allows you to create your own photo tour without worrying about parking. You’re welcome.

Where To Find It: 31 Stops from Robertson to LaBrea
